Key Product Categories

  • Abrasive Suspensions:

    Contain fine abrasive particles (ceramics, alumina, silica) dispersed in a liquid medium, used for surface finishing and microstructure analysis.

  • Lubricant-Enhanced Suspensions:

    Incorporate lubricants to reduce surface damage and improve surface quality during polishing.

  • Eco-Friendly Suspensions:

    Formulations emphasizing biodegradability and low toxicity, aligning with sustainability goals.
